5.Introduction to help you PMI Requirements [Original Website]

When it comes to purchasing a home, there are many factors to consider. One of the most important is private Mortgage insurance (PMI). PMI is a type of insurance that protects the lender in case the debtor non-payments on the loan. PMI is typically required for borrowers who put down less than 20% of the home’s purchase price. In this section, we will provide an introduction to pmi criteria and you may what first-big date homebuyers need to know.

step one. information PMI conditions: PMI conditions are very different according to the bank as well as the style of loan. not, there are standard assistance that all individuals should be aware of regarding. PMI is usually needed for old-fashioned finance having a down payment from below 20% of your own cost. The price of PMI can vary, but it’s constantly doing 0.3% to a single.5% of the brand-new amount borrowed a year. PMI is usually requisite till the debtor has actually repaid 20% of your residence’s worth.
